Tracing the Origins of the Dart Game Evolution Timeline
Pinpointing the exact origin of darts is difficult, shrouded in the mists of time and folklore. However, the generally accepted theory traces its roots back to medieval England. It is believed that soldiers, passing time between battles, would throw shortened arrows or spearheads at the bottoms of upturned wine barrels or tree trunks.
- Early forms likely involved throwing objects at a target.
- Tree trunks are a commonly cited early target.
- Distance and accuracy were key factors in these early contests.
Over time, this pastime evolved and began to take on a more structured form. As the practice moved indoors, often into taverns and pubs, the need for a more standardized target became apparent. This marked a crucial step in the **dart game evolution timeline**.
The Butcher’s Dartboard: A Glimpse into Early Standardization
One of the earliest forms of a standardized dartboard was known as the “Butcher’s Board.” This board featured a simple layout with concentric circles and radiating lines, providing a more challenging and quantifiable target. The segments weren’t necessarily numbered at this point, but the board’s design allowed for a greater degree of skill and precision.
These early dartboards were often handcrafted, leading to variations in size and layout. The lack of universal standards meant that the rules of the game could vary from pub to pub, adding a local flavor to the sport. These local variations can be considered forgotten pub dart games now.
The Rise of Standardized Rules and the Modern Dartboard
A significant turning point in the **dart game evolution timeline** came with the development of standardized rules and the modern dartboard layout. This period saw the emergence of influential figures who sought to formalize the game and create a more consistent experience for players.
Brian Gamlin, a carpenter from Lancashire, England, is often credited with devising the numbering system for the modern dartboard in 1896. However, definitive proof of this is lacking, and other theories exist. Regardless of the true inventor, the numbering system, with its strategic placement of high and low scores to punish inaccuracy, added a new level of complexity and skill to the game.
The placement of numbers like 20, 5, 1, 12, 9, and 14 around the board is no accident. This seemingly random arrangement is designed to penalize slightly errant throws. Hitting near the 20 is good, but a slight mistake could land you on the 1 or 5. The evolution of the game’s regulations is also part of the history of darts games uk.
The Importance of the Flight and Dart Design
Beyond the board itself, the design of the darts themselves also underwent significant evolution. Early darts were often simple wooden shafts with feathers attached for stability. Over time, materials and designs improved, leading to greater accuracy and control. The development of different flight shapes and materials allowed players to customize their darts to suit their throwing style.
- Feather flights were common in early darts.
- Later, paper and then plastic flights emerged.
- Tungsten barrels allowed for slimmer, denser darts.
The use of tungsten for dart barrels, for example, allowed for a slimmer dart with the same weight as a brass dart, leading to tighter groupings on the board and higher scores. Choosing the right dart is crucial for any serious player.
Dart Game Evolution Timeline: From Pub Game to Professional Sport
The 20th century witnessed the transformation of darts from a casual pub game into a recognized professional sport. The establishment of governing bodies, standardized rules, and organized competitions played a crucial role in this process.
The formation of organizations like the British Darts Organisation (BDO) and the Professional Darts Corporation (PDC) provided a framework for the sport, setting rules, organizing tournaments, and promoting the game to a wider audience. These organizations helped to legitimize darts and attract sponsorship, further fueling its growth.
The Impact of Television and Media Coverage
Television played a pivotal role in popularizing darts and transforming it into a spectator sport. The broadcasting of major tournaments brought the excitement and drama of darts into homes around the world, attracting new fans and inspiring aspiring players. Commentators like Sid Waddell added to the spectacle with their colorful personalities and enthusiastic commentary.
The rise of televised darts also led to the emergence of star players who became household names. Figures like Eric Bristow, Phil Taylor, and Michael van Gerwen captivated audiences with their skill, charisma, and fierce rivalries. The influence of these players on the **dart game evolution timeline** is undeniable.
Technological Advancements and the Future of Darts
Modern technology continues to shape the **dart game evolution timeline**. From electronic dartboards to sophisticated scoring systems and online platforms, technology is enhancing the playing experience and expanding the reach of the sport.
Electronic dartboards, for example, automatically calculate scores and eliminate the need for manual scoring, making the game more accessible and convenient. Online darts platforms allow players to compete against opponents from around the world, fostering a global community of darts enthusiasts. These advances tie in with the Darts Variants Fun Games we know today.
The Rise of Online Darts and Virtual Tournaments
The COVID-19 pandemic accelerated the adoption of online darts and virtual tournaments. With traditional competitions canceled or postponed, players and fans turned to online platforms to stay connected and continue playing the game. This trend is likely to continue, with online darts becoming an increasingly important part of the darts landscape.
